Improv March Madness: Dual Duel Competition (Opening Rounds)
Mar 7 @ 7:00 pm
Alchemy Comedy Theater at Coffee Underground

Every March for over 10 years, Alchemy’s stage becomes a full-on comedy battle as duos of improvisers compete for points and your laughs!

It’s a bit like “Whose Line Is It Anyway?”. You’ll see familiar games like ABC (if the first line starts with an A, the next line will start with a B, then a C, and so on …), New Choice (the host will ring a bell and the player has to replace their last line with something totally new), and Sounds Like a Rap (exactly what you’d expect).

But, unlike “Whose Line?”, the points matter. It’s a head to head tournament where players are eliminated, dreams are made, as teams move towards the final round.

At the end of the month, only one team will go home as Alchemy’s March Madness Champions to win $222.22!

The Chipper Experience: Where Comedy + Magic Collide
Mar 23 @ 7:30 pm
Gunter Theatre

Two-time “Comedy Magician of the Year,” Chipper Lowell, continues to be one of the top favorites among theater-goers, young and old! His original blend of side-splitting comedy, highly original magic, mentalism, hilarious audience interaction, and more, has been entertaining audiences for the last 25+ years!

Chipper has appeared multiple times on The Tonight Show, The Disney Channel, America’s Funniest People!, Street Magic, Show Me the Funny!, Don’t Blink!, That’s Incredible, America’s Funniest People, Everybody’s Talking, two Christmas Magic! specials, as well as 50+ guest appearances on all ten seasons of the CW’s hit series: Masters of Illusion. Described by the press as a “Cyclone of high-energy wit & laughs, and jaw-dropping magic!”, Chipper has performed all over the world, including the U.S., Canada, Mexico, England, Malaysia, Bahamas, Australia, and New Zealand.

Chipper most recently received the prestigious Senator Crandall Award for “Excellence in Comedy” and was nominated three times in the past 8 years for “Stage Magician of the Year!” by the Academy of Magical Arts (aka The Magic Castle in Los Angeles). He was also named as one of the “Top Funniest Magicians” performing today by Magic Magazine and honored with “Specialty Act of the Year!” from the Tahoe Daily Tribune and the Sacramento Bee. In addition to his solo tour dates of his critically-acclaimed solo show – The Chipper Experience! – Where Comedy & Magic Collide! – he has starred in several international stage productions and touring companies, including The Illusionists, Unbelievable!, The HITS!, Moon River & Me, Masters of Illusion – LIVE!, and Circus 1903.

Audiences and critics alike continue to rave about his hilarious onstage antics. Chipper’s show is a nonstop, roller coaster of original magic, mentalism, bizarre juggling stunts, and edgy yet corporate-clean comedy, peppered with rapid-fire ad-libs, improv, and audience participation. 50th Anniversary of Prairie Home Companion
Mar 26 @ 7:30 pm
Peace Concert Hall

Almost 50 years ago — on July 6, 1974 — Garrison Keillor hosted the first broadcast of A Prairie Home Companion, and the perennially popular weekly radio show remained on the air until July of 2016, with its music, comedy sketches, and accounts of life in tiny Lake Wobegon (where the women are strong, the men are good-looking, and the children are all above average). Since the show ended, the author and humorist has continued to take the stage at venues nationwide — much to the delight of legions of fans.

In the coming months, Keillor takes A Prairie Home Companion’s 50th Anniversary Tour across the U.S. Joining Keillor are charming singer-actor Christine DiGiallonardo, dazzling vocalist Heather Masse, the ever-popular Royal Academy of Actors (Tim RussellSue Scott, and sound-effects wizard Fred Newman), music director/keyboardist Richard Dworsky, and others to be announced.

Born in 1942 in Anoka, Minnesota, Garrison Keillor developed a love of writing in childhood. “I started out with a No. 2 pencil and pads of paper, then acquired an Underwood manual typewriter with a faint F and a misshapen O,” he says. Five years after getting a job in public radio “doing the 6 a.m. shift Monday to Friday, because nobody else wanted to get up so early,” he wrote a piece for The New Yorker about the Grand Ole Opry and got the idea to launch A Prairie Home Companion. 

These days, his in-person humor-filled shows are a treat for folks young and not-so-young. He has written dozens of books —including novels, a book of sonnets, a collection of limericks, a memoir, a political homily, and most recently, Cheerfulness. His biweekly online column can be found on Substack.
